How to create or import a taxonomy

To use a taxonomy within your account, you must first add and activate it.
To create a taxonomy, simply go to your account settings.
Select the “Taxonomies” tab. Once inside, click the “Create a new taxonomy” button to configure its settings.

When creating a variable, you can edit its properties so that it aligns with the requirements you need.

You can also define one or more variables as a “Definition”, meaning they will have a predefined default value that is recalled every time the same variable is used.
Once you have finished filling in all the information, you can either save the taxonomy and keep it deactivated, or publish it using the three dots at the top right, so that it becomes available for use in your contracts (here a guide).
